Title: The Innovative Journey of Im-Soo Mok
Introduction: Im-Soo Mok, an accomplished inventor based in Gumi-si, South Korea, has made significant contributions to the field of energy systems. With a keen focus on improving power supply solutions, Mok has secured a patent that showcases his expertise and innovation.
Latest Patents: Mok's notable patent, titled "Micro-grid system with un-interruptible power supply," presents a unique solution for ensuring reliable power in various applications. The patent outlines a micro-grid system that includes a first node receiving AC power from a bus system and a first generator applying DC power to a second node. This system is designed to manage multiple loads effectively, including AC and DC power distribution, using advanced converter technology. The integration of a switch unit further enhances the adaptability of the micro-grid, allowing for efficient management of the power supply.
